Single Family Residential District
The single family districts provide for a limited range of housing densities consistent with the Village's established residential neighborhoods. The R-A District allows for lower density residential use and larger lot sizes. The R-B and R-C Districts allow for somewhat higher density residential use and smaller lot sizes.
